when I built my first pair 10 years ago, all the ski and mould materials, including the CNC milling and the vacuum pump I used to press the skis all in was about $1200. Now you’d be looking for closer to $1800
I built a pair of powder skis and despite their simple construction they skied well enough. Had I known more about how they would flex I would have slimmed the core down more as they were kind of dead flex. I then went on to build plenty more of increasing quality and complexity.
if you’re methodical, do plenty research befor jumping in and you’ve got woodshop, arts & crafts and diy skills it’s relatively achievable to get a half decent pair out your first attempt.
